Ajax Post请求数据中加号变空格的解决方法

在WEB编程中,经常需要与后台交互,我们可以通过AJAX方式,但是在使用POST提交数据时,如果参数中含有特殊字符,则需要我们特殊处理,将这些字符进行转义。例如POST请求的参数中包含+号,则在后台获取数据时,加号变成了空格。下面介绍具体的解决方法。
时间:2016-8-7

ajax 向后台传递数组参数

jquery中使用ajax与服务器端交互时,如果需要向服务端传递参数时如果参数是一个类或者是个数组以及更复杂的对象时,该如何传递参数呢?
时间:2015-7-6

ajax特殊字符的处理

Ajax在post方式提交表单的时候,一些特殊字符的处理问题,需要特别注意。网上大多数提到的字符包括:“&”和“+”,其实还有一个重要的空格。如果你发现你的表单数据提交之后,有些字符丢失或字符变化,请注意一下,对表单数据进行编码。下面介绍ajax提交表单时如何传递特殊字符
时间:2015-4-1

$.ajax的用法

jquery中$.ajax用于通过HTTP请求加载远程数据。简单易用的高层实现有$.get, $.post 等。$.ajax() 返回其创建的XMLHttpRequest 对象。下面介绍$.ajax的参数
时间:2015-3-1

jquery ajax的async使用

jquery的$.ajax的async属性默认的设置值为true,这种情况为异步方式,当ajax发送请求后,在等待server端返回的这个过程中,前台会继续执行ajax块后面的脚本,直到server端返回正确的结果才会去执行success。
时间:2015-1-14

如何解决AJAX 的缓存

在默认情况下,浏览器会针对请求地址缓存Ajax请求的结果。换句话说,在缓存过期之前,针对相同地址发起的多个Ajax请求,只有第一次会真正发送到服务端。在某些情况下,这种默认的缓存机制并不是我们希望的(比如获取实时数据)。
时间:2014-12-12

ajax回调函数不执行

在用jquery写一些ajax功能时,通过Jquery的Post方法,把Json数据传到后台,处理后却怎么都不进入回调函数,jquery的ajax回调函数不能执行了。
时间:2014-10-18

jquery.ajax error 如何调试错误

JQuery使我们在开发Ajax应用程序的时候提高了效率,减少了许多兼容性问题,我们在Ajax项目中,遇到ajax异步获取数据出错怎么办,我们可以通过捕捉error事件来获取出错的信息。
时间:2013-10-18